More businesses moving to Nebraska
8 Mar 2017
Andrew Tuzson and his wife, Angela, were living in Denver but getting ready to make a move to Nebraska.
The couple had had it with Denver’s long commute time.
“With the three kids, we were really, really ready for a change of pace. We were really wanting to inject ourselves into a community that was really family-focused,” Andrew Tuzson said.
They created lists and looked at opportunities. Lincoln remained at the top of those lists because of the family aspect and its booming economy, he said.
Tuzson grew up in western Nebraska, but had been gone for years, the past 12 in Colorado, where he and Angela, who’s from Wichita, Kansas, started a business in their basement.
They decided to visit Lincoln, and while here, check out office space in the Haymarket. Even before they got in their car to head back to Colorado they had made up their minds, Andrew Tuzson said.
